Linearization• Algebraically, the principle of local linearity means that the
equation of the tangent line defines a function that can be used to approximate a differentiable function near the point of tangency,
• The equation of the tangent line is given a new name: the linearization of f at a.
• Recall point-slope form of a line: y=m(x-x1)+y1
• The tangent line at (a, f(a)) can be written:
y=f ’(a)(x-a)+f(a)

Amazingly close to zero!
This is Newton’s Method of finding roots. It is an example of an algorithm (a specific set of computational steps.)
It is sometimes called the Newton-Raphson method
This is a recursive algorithm because a set of steps are repeated with the previous answer put in the next repetition. Each repetition is called an iteration.
